The aggressive stripping of components often resulted in "collateral damage." Users frequently discovered that certain third-party software wouldn't install because a hidden dependency—like a specific .NET Framework component or a cryptography service—had been deleted. Additionally, plugging in new hardware often resulted in failure because the core driver framework required to recognize the device was missing.
